Introducing ITTRC
The International Textile Trade & Recycling Council (ITTRC) is a global industry platform committed to creating a more sustainable, resilient, and circular textile ecosystem.
We bring together stakeholders across the entire textile value chain to promote responsible trade, innovative recycling solutions, sustainable manufacturing practices, environmental stewardship, and international cooperation.
Through policy engagement, research, innovation, capacity building, and strategic partnerships, ITTRC supports the transition toward a circular textile economy that balances economic growth with environmental responsibility.

Challenges We Address
Rising Textile Waste
Millions of tons of garments landfill each year.
Limited Recycling
Infrastructure bottlenecks delay systemic reuse.
Carbon Emissions
High carbon footprint across logistics & processing.
Water Pollution
Chemical wastewater runoffs damaging environments.
Complex Supply Chains
Opaque flows make sustainable sourcing verification difficult.
Circular Gaps
Lack of integrated design-to-recycle pathways.
